Frank DeLuca Donates $10,000 To Boys & Girls Club of Marion County

In a recent ceremony at the Dr. HL Harrell Youth Center, DeLuca Toyota showed their commitment to the community by donating $10,000 to the Boys & Girls Club of Marion County. This significant contribution, presented by Mr. Frank and Angela DeLuca, brings substantial support to the youth of Marion County.

A special wall reveal in the game room showed the club’s mission to provide a safe and nurturing environment for local youth, followed by an Ocala Metro Chamber and Economic Partnership ribbon-cutting ceremony.

DeLuca Toyota has been a steadfast supporter of the Boys & Girls Club since 2016, contributing a total of $130,000 over the years. This ongoing support has been instrumental in helping the organization provide essential services and programs to young people across Marion County.

The donation will be used to further enhance the programs and facilities offered by the Boys & Girls Club, ensuring that more children and teens in Marion County have access to the tools they need to succeed.
